Hardware Limitations¶
General hardware limitations apply when using the GPU compositor. See also Troubleshooting Graphics Hardware.
Blender uses the same GPU resources for the UI as well as for the GPU compositor. This have a number of consequences, each of which is described in one of the following sections.
UI Freezes¶
Unlike rendering with Cycles, the UI might become irresponsive when using the GPU compositor for some slower GPUs.
TDR on Windows¶
Timeout Detection Recovery (TDR) resets the GPU driver if a GPU compositing task takes longer than the default 2 second limit. This is especially common with older GPUs when using expensive nodes like Bokeh Blur node. To prevent unexpected resets, it is recommended to increase the TDR timeout.
